University Cafeterias Disappear, Impacting Student Well-being and Future Prospects

Burundi2 hr ago

University catering services have progressively vanished since 2018, primarily due to budgetary constraints. Some officials argued that universities should concentrate solely on their academic missions and that students should bear a larger portion of their expenses. Consequently, the state shifted its focus to a student loan and scholarship system. This decision has left many students struggling to afford adequate nutrition, a situation that raises concerns about their academic performance and overall health. The lack of affordable food options on campus forces students to spend more time and money seeking meals elsewhere, often leading to reliance on less healthy and more expensive alternatives. This decline in student welfare is seen as detrimental to the nation's future, as well-nourished students are considered crucial for academic success and future contributions to the country. The disappearance of university restaurants highlights a broader debate about the state's responsibility in supporting students beyond purely academic provisions.
